Letter from S. Smith & Sons acknowledging a report of a fractured junction box on a Rolls 25 and confirming a replacement part has been dispatched.

Hs{Lord Ernest Hives - Chair}/Bwg.{J. C. Bowring}6/KW. 3rd September 1935. Messrs. Rolls Royce Ltd., DERBY. For the attention of Mr. J.{Mr Johnson W.M.} C. Bowering. Dear Sirs, "Jackalls" - 21-G-IV. We beg to acknowledge receipt of your letter of the 2nd instant, together with sketch showing the fracture in the junction box as fitted to the front axle of the Rolls 25. We have sent forward a replacement under separate cover to our Delivery Note No. 13013 and shall esteem it a favour if you will return the broken part at some future date to suit your convenience, purely for inspection purposes. Assuring you of our very best attention at all times, Yours faithfully, pp. S. SMITH & SONS (Motor Accessories) Ltd. E H Bailey Manager. Fitting Dept.
